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our team arrives quickly, equipped with the necessary tools to assess the damage and contain the affected area. We use moisture meters to detect water levels and identify the source of the leak. Time is of the essence and we act quickly to prevent further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ract water from your home, reducing the risk of further damage and preventing secondary damage from occurring. We’re thorough and we’re efficient ensuring that every last drop of water is removed.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team uses spec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including air movers and dehumidifiers. We work tirelessly to ensure that your home is completely dry and free from moisture, preventing the growth of mold and mildew.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Once the affected area is dry, our team begins the restoration process, repairing any damaged walls, floors, and ceilings. We use high-quality materials to ensure that your home is restored to its original condition, matching the original finish and texture.

Warning Signs You Need Water Removal Services
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s, health hazards, and even structural issues. Don’t wait to address the problem; act now. Here are some warning signs that you need water removal services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. Don’t ignore these smells, as they can spread quickly and cause health problems.
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ings
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leaky pipe or a cracked foundation. Don’t delay in addressing these stains, as they can lead to further damage.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Warped or buckled floors can show that the water has seeped into the subfloor, causing structural issues.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can show that the water has caused damage to the underlying surfaces. Don’t delay in addressing these issues, as they can lead to further damage.
Unusual Sounds or Sights
Unusual sounds or sights, such as dripping water or water spots, can show that there’s a problem with your home’s plumbing or foundation.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s.
High Utility Bills
High utility bills can show that there’s a problem with your home’s insulation or plumbing. Don’t delay in addressing these issues, as they can lead to further damage and increased costs.

Residential Water Removal Cost in Albany, NY
The cost of water remov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Albany, NY. Estimates are available and our team will work with you to develop a customized plan to fit your budget and need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required |
| Drying and d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and duration of drying process |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of repairs, materials required, and labor costs |
| Moisture detection and inspection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and complexity of inspection |
| Containment and isolation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ials required, and labor costs |

Common Questions About Residential Water Removal
What causes water damage in homes?
Water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ks, floods, and burst pipes.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ent these issues.
How long does water removal take?
The duration of water remov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team works efficiently to complete the process as quickly as possible.
Is water removal covered by insurance?
Yes, water removal services may be covered by insurance, depending on the cause of the damage and the terms of your policy. Check with your provider to find out your coverage.
How can I prevent water damage in my home?
Preventing water damage needs regular maintenance and inspections. Check your pipes insulate your home and monitor your water bill to detect potential issues early.
